I just thought I'd make mention of my observation of repeating patterns in the NW since the Olympia 2/28/01 quake.

Fist there was activity off shore of Vancouver Island, then comes the Olympia quake, lots of small quakes up and down the NS corrider near Puget Sound and then things picked up in Eastern WA with Colville and Spokane.

Though we don't have years of data collected to form any kind of hypotheses I'm sure some very intelligent geo scientists are noting this pattern as well and I'm sure at some not so distant point in time a paper noting this pattern will emerge.

So what should we expect the in days - months ahead? Another moderate quake with 50K of Olympia and of course more off shore activity around Vancouver Island and then more repeats in the Eastern WA areas. If vulcanism comes into play, which is surely not out of the realm of possibilities, it may not be Mt. Rainier that comes to life, but another one most likely north of Mt. Rainier. Why? Because the largest off shore quakes are north of Rainier.
